Tanguy Pruvot
17cf3767e9
api: also fix nvapi mapping and double swap on histo
2014-11-18 03:34:23 +01:00
Tanguy Pruvot
582c971f2b
api: fix histo gpu/thr id mismatch
2014-11-17 19:11:26 +01:00
Tanguy Pruvot
047e79a9fc
api: add meminfo query to debug mem storages
2014-11-17 16:17:53 +01:00
Tanguy Pruvot
59391e25ec
api: fix includes after a test on mingw (cpuminer)
2014-11-16 17:34:50 +01:00
Tanguy Pruvot
3e43553735
api: export card labels and count, renames stats command
...
renammed to "threads", stats was too much generic
2014-11-14 23:38:16 +01:00
Tanguy Pruvot
cc05128ae3
api: fix histo thread param
2014-11-14 20:30:42 +01:00
Tanguy Pruvot
124dc6ea57
nvapi: fix mapping of devices
2014-11-14 19:33:24 +01:00
Tanguy Pruvot
3652c708b9
api: add histo command and difficulty
...
enhance multi-gpu stats and fix nvapi indexes
change syslog prefix to ccminer (cpuminer remains)
api 1.1 modified - not officially released yet
2014-11-14 19:09:48 +01:00
Tanguy Pruvot
3d2260acc4
stats: add support for current freq and pstate
...
windows only via nvapi, if nvml function is not supported
2014-11-14 02:48:27 +01:00
Tanguy Pruvot
e139736a2f
api: better compat with telnet + help command
...
handle "\r\n" and terminate connection if command is not known
2014-11-14 01:32:10 +01:00
Tanguy Pruvot
e40a7a720c
ccminer: rename main file and switch to C++
...
There was a different behavior on linux and visual studio
That was making it hard to link functions correctly
That remove some ifdef / extern "C" requirements
note about x86 releases, x86 nvml.dll is not installed on Windows x64!
2014-11-13 16:11:35 +01:00
Tanguy Pruvot
49f3c454c2
Add nvml for GPU monitoring (squashed)
...
Based on mwhite73 <marvin.white@gmail.com> implementation
Linked to the api system
Also fix Makefile to support standard c++ files
This prevent nvcc use without device code
Signed-off-by: Tanguy Pruvot <tanguy.pruvot@gmail.com>
2014-11-13 14:36:18 +01:00